Job 19:13-20

13  “He has put my a brothers far from me,
and b those who knew me are wholly estranged from me.
14 My relatives c have failed me,
my close d friends have forgotten me.
15 The guests e in my house and my maidservants count me as a stranger;
I have become a foreigner in their eyes.
16 I call to my servant, but he gives me no answer;
I must plead with him with my mouth for mercy.
17 My breath is strange to my f wife,
and I am a stench to the children of g my own mother.
18 Even young h children despise me;
when I rise they talk against me.
19 All my i intimate friends abhor me,
and those whom I loved have turned against me.
20 My j bones stick to my skin and to my flesh,
and I have escaped by the skin of my teeth.
